> Log:
> On the log-addressing branch:  For low-overhead checksumming,
> add standard FNV-1a and a faster modified version of that to
> the list of checksum kinds supported with svn_checksum_t.
>
> We will use this new checksum to secure parts of FSFS (and
> later FSX) that are not directly covered by MD5/SHA1 content
> checksums.  That will help to localize corruptions much quicker
> and more accurately but it will not eliminate the need to run
> a full content verification.

If you're using this for detecting corruption, rather than key
distribution, why not instead use a 64-bit or even 32-bit CRC? It should
be much faster than any kind of multiply-with-prime hash.
